Stay in Control



More bills in the mail? Open some of those envelopes in front of your kids. Calmly show them just how much that cable costs every month, and point out due-dates and extra charges for movies or services. Let them peek at your budget or your list of monthly expenses. Act like the family CEO. After all, your family is your business! When you act like you’re in control, they'll feel like money is nothing to fear.
